StdFace
An input file generator for quantum lattice model solvers developed at ISSP, University of Tokyo.
Overview
StdFace reads a simple configuration file specifying the physical model and lattice geometry, then generates solver-specific input files for:
- HPhi - Exact Diagonalization
- mVMC - Variational Monte Carlo
- UHF - Unrestricted Hartree-Fock
- H-wave - Mean-field solver
Features
- Simple
key = valueinput format - Support for various lattice geometries and physical models
- Wannier90 format support for ab-initio calculations
- Single codebase for multiple solver backends
Supported Lattices
| Lattice Type | Description |
|--------------|-------------|
| chain | 1D chain |
| ladder | 2-leg ladder |
| square | 2D square lattice |
| triangular | 2D triangular lattice |
| honeycomb | 2D honeycomb lattice |
| kagome | 2D kagome lattice |
| tetragonal | 3D tetragonal lattice |
| orthorhombic | 3D orthorhombic lattice |
| fcortho | Face-centered orthorhombic |
| pyrochlore | 3D pyrochlore lattice |
| wannier90 | Import from Wannier90 files |
Supported Models
- Hubbard model
- Spin models
- Kondo lattice model
Requirements
- CMake 2.8.12 or later
- C99-compatible compiler (GCC, Clang, Intel, Fujitsu, etc.)
Installation
git clone https://github.com/issp-center-dev/StdFace
cd StdFace
cmake -B build -DHPHI=ON # Enable HPhi mode
cmake --build build
cmake --install build --prefix /path/to/install
Build Options
Enable one or more solver modes:
| Option | Executable | Target Solver |
|--------|------------|---------------|
| -DHPHI=ON | hphi_dry.out | HPhi (Exact Diagonalization) |
| -DMVMC=ON | mvmc_dry.out | mVMC (Variational Monte Carlo) |
| -DUHF=ON | uhf_dry.out | UHF (Unrestricted Hartree-Fock) |
| -DHWAVE=ON | hwave_dry.out | H-wave |
Build all solvers:
cmake -B build -DHPHI=ON -DMVMC=ON -DUHF=ON -DHWAVE=ON
cmake --build build
Quick Start
- Create an input file
stan.in:
model = "Hubbard"
lattice = square
W = 2
L = 2
t = 1.0
U = 4.0
nelec = 4
2Sz = 0
- Run StdFace:
./hphi_dry.out stan.in
- Input files for the target solver are generated in the current directory.
